Transaction 2763f66fd38bf13dfae714cdc79a1add6c70679c65377b11ca58cba381f2b75b

5 Input
2 Outputs
  • 2763f66fd38bf13dfae714cdc79a1add6c70679c65377b11ca58cba381f2b75b:0
  • value  675000000
    address  1JWCi293PwtTzC6o9Yc5ERYmJVeCGpuEpz
  • 2763f66fd38bf13dfae714cdc79a1add6c70679c65377b11ca58cba381f2b75b:1
  • value  1000641
    address  14kE5Gh8YRrYmp5S86SLnL8YKPeVMVYP3Z